Who ever heard of a funeral for a puppet?!?!? In this case it is was French composer, Charles Gounod, who composed a funeral march for a marionette (stringed puppet). Several videos are included from 3 ½ to 6 minutes. Guided listening helps visualize the march. A life sketch of Charles Gounod (pronounced goo-no) and several activities including a make-your-own marionette are all part of this packet.

Lesson includes digital links to YouTube videos and free audio files. There are also several musical activities, drama activities, writing activities, dance activities and art activities to go along. Additionally, there is information about the composer, Charles Gounod.

This is the perfect lesson and activity for elementary school children and teachers. The song is about 4 minutes long and the lesson could take about 30 minutes. Depending on the activity or activities you choose they could take anywhere from 15 minutes to a couple of days.
